home *** CD-ROM | disk | FTP | other *** search
/ Otherware / Otherware_1_SB_Development.iso / mac / util / unix / macutil2.sha / macutil / macunpack / lzc.h < prev    next >
Encoding:
C/C++ Source or Header  |  1992-11-05  |  599 b   |  30 lines

  1. #define HEADERBYTES 48
  2. #define MAGIC1    "\253\315\000\060"
  3. #define MAGIC2    "\037\235"
  4.  
  5. #define C_DLENOFF    4
  6. #define C_DLENOFFC    8
  7. #define C_RLENOFF    12
  8. #define C_RLENOFFC    16
  9. #define C_MTIMOFF    24
  10. #define C_CTIMOFF    28
  11. #define C_TYPEOFF    32
  12. #define C_AUTHOFF    36
  13. #define C_FLAGOFF    40
  14.  
  15. typedef struct fileHdr {
  16.     unsigned long    magic1;
  17.     unsigned long    dataLength;
  18.     unsigned long    dataCLength;
  19.     unsigned long    rsrcLength;
  20.     unsigned long    rsrcCLength;
  21.     unsigned long    unknown1;
  22.     unsigned long    mtime;
  23.     unsigned long    ctime;
  24.     unsigned long    filetype;
  25.     unsigned long    fileauth;
  26.     unsigned long    flag1;
  27.     unsigned long    flag2;
  28. };
  29.  
  30.